Zakopane railway station

Zakopane railway station is a railway station in Zakopane (Lesser Poland), Poland and the terminus of PKP rail line 99. The station was opened in 1899 and electrified in 1975. It is also the highest situated staffed railway station in Poland at 835 metres above sea level. As of 2023, it is served by Koleje Śląskie (Silesian Voivodeship Railways), Polregio, and PKP Intercity (EIC, InterCity, and TLK services).

Train services

The station is served by the following services:

  • Express Intercity services (EIC) Warsaw - Kraków - Zakopane
  • Intercity services (IC) Warsaw - Kraków - Zakopane
  • Intercity services (IC) Gdynia - Gdańsk - Bydgoszcz - Łódź - Czestochowa — Krakow — Zakopane
  • Intercity services (IC) Bydgoszcz - Poznań - Leszno - Wrocław - Opole - Rybnik - Bielsko-Biała - Zakopane
  • Intercity services (IC) Szczecin - Białogard - Szczecinek - Piła - Poznań - Ostrów Wielkopolski - Katowice - Zakopane
  • Intercity services (TLK) Gdynia Główna — Zakopane
  • Regional services (PR) Kraków Główny — Skawina — Sucha Beskidzka — Chabówka — Nowy Targ — Zakopane
  • Regional services (KŚ) Katowice - Pszczyna - Bielsko-Biała Gł - Å»ywiec - Nowy Targ - Zakopane

services operating between Chabówka or Nowy Targ and Zakopane only are branded as Podhalańska Kolej Regionalna (Podhale Regional Railway).
